Burnley Surname Meaning
English (Lancashire and Yorkshire): habitational name from Burnley in Lancashire so named with the Old English river name Brun (from brūn ‘brown’ or burna ‘stream’).
It signifies a geographical connection to the area where the name originated.
The name combines elements that describe both the natural features and the landscape of the place.
The term lēah refers to a woodland clearing, indicating the presence of wooded areas nearby.
This etymology reflects the historical relationship between the inhabitants and their environment.
